Changeset View
Changeset View
Standalone View
Standalone View
src/backendlauncher/backenddbuswrapper.h
Show All 37 Lines | |||||
38 | public: | 38 | public: | ||
39 | explicit BackendDBusWrapper(KScreen::AbstractBackend *backend); | 39 | explicit BackendDBusWrapper(KScreen::AbstractBackend *backend); | ||
40 | ~BackendDBusWrapper() override; | 40 | ~BackendDBusWrapper() override; | ||
41 | 41 | | |||
42 | bool init(); | 42 | bool init(); | ||
43 | 43 | | |||
44 | QVariantMap getConfig() const; | 44 | QVariantMap getConfig() const; | ||
45 | QVariantMap setConfig(const QVariantMap &config); | 45 | QVariantMap setConfig(const QVariantMap &config); | ||
46 | QByteArray getEdid(int output) const; | 46 | QVariantMap getEdid(int output) const; | ||
47 | 47 | | |||
48 | inline KScreen::AbstractBackend *backend() const { return mBackend; } | 48 | inline KScreen::AbstractBackend *backend() const { return mBackend; } | ||
49 | 49 | | |||
50 | Q_SIGNALS: | 50 | Q_SIGNALS: | ||
51 | void configChanged(const QVariantMap &config); | 51 | void configChanged(const QVariantMap &config); | ||
52 | 52 | | |||
53 | private Q_SLOTS: | 53 | private Q_SLOTS: | ||
54 | void backendConfigChanged(const KScreen::ConfigPtr &config); | 54 | void backendConfigChanged(const KScreen::ConfigPtr &config); | ||
Show All 11 Lines |